7. Q:What is the conversion efficiency of the inverter
A: In operation the inverter itself also consume part of the power, so that it is greater than
the input power to its output power, the efficiency of the inverter is the inverter input power
and output power ratio, such as a single inverter input a 100W DC output of the AC 90W,
then its conversion efficiency is 90%

9. Q:What is the inductive load
A: Application of the principle of electromagnetic induction produced by high-power electrical products, such as motors, compressors, relays, fluorescent lamps, electric stove,
refrigerator, air conditioning, energy saving lamps, water pumps. Such products at start of
instantaneous power far rated than power operation (3-7 times), such products need to purchase pure mysterious wave load
10. Q:What is a continuous power, what is the peak power?
A:The general use of the motor or electrical tools, such as: refrigerators, washing machines,
drills, etc., in an instant startup requires a lot of current to drive, once started successfully,
only a small current to maintain its normal operation, therefore, the inverse change is concerned,
and will have a continuous output power and the peak power of the concept of continuous
output power is the rated output power, typically the peak output power is 2 times the rated
output power, it must be emphasized that some appliances, such as: air conditioning, refrigerator
and other starting current equivalent to the normal working 3-7 times, since only the peak power can meet the electrical inverter starts to work properly.

12. Q:How long the inverter can work?
A: Use time depends on the size of the battery capacity, this formula can be approximately
calculated using the time
Formula: Working time = voltage of the battery capacity * negative * 0.8 * 0.9 / electrical power.
For example: a 12V60A battery, driving a 200V100W device.
Working Hours = 12V * 60A * 0.8 * 0.9 / 100W = 5.184 hours
Note: 0.8 is the battery discharge coefficient 0.9 is the conversion efficiency of the inverter,
the specific use of time and your battery related depreciation
